Summary

Bruno Guimarães has officially signed with Arsenal from Newcastle United for £75 million. The Brazilian midfielder is expected to bolster Arsenal's creativity, particularly in breaking down defensive teams. Having previously impressed during his time at Newcastle, Guimarães is motivated to seize this opportunity after a disappointing World Cup exit with Brazil. He is prepared to contribute both defensively and offensively in Arsenal’s setup. The club aims to further leverage his skills, especially on set-pieces.

While able to play deeper, the onus will also be on Arsenal’s £75m signing to provide creativity in an attack that has struggled to break down the low block Data shows deal could be another set-piece masterstroke If there was one of his many assets Newcastle supporters grew to love above all about Bruno Guimarães then it was best summed up by the man himself after being unveiled as Arsenal’s new £75m signing. “That’s a tough one,” said the Brazil midfielder when asked what fans in north London can expect from him. “I would say I can pass the ball, run a lot and play like a warrior. I’ll never give up.” After more than four years on Tyneside and having seen Alexander Isak, Anthony Gordon and Sandro Tonali precede Eddie Howe’s departure, Guimarães – who was devastated after missing a penalty for the Seleção in their defeat against Norway in the last 16 of the World Cup – was determined to seize his opportunity.
